About Renting a Car at BC Zaporizhzhia Train Station

Zaporizhzhia train station (Zaporizhzhia-1) is located in the southern part of the center, about 3 km from the city's heart on Sobornyi Avenue. The station is a natural starting point for travelers who want to explore the Dnipro region by rental car. From the station, it's about 8 km to Khortytsia island via the Preobrazhensky Bridge, and Dnipro city is reached in approximately 1 hour north via M18.

The station is near Zaporizhzhia-1 metro station, which provides good public transportation connections. Pick up your rental car at the station and drive directly towards Khortytsia island for a historic start to your journey. Plan a route to Nikopol, about 100 km west, to see the landscape of Cossack history.

Avoid rush hour traffic on Sobornyi Avenue during the morning hours. How far is it from the train station to Khortytsia island? About 8 km, approximately 15–20 minutes by car via the Preobrazhensky Bridge.

🚙 Driving in Ukraine

In Ukraine you drive on the Right side.

  • Urban speed limit: 50 km/h
  • Rural roads: 90 km/h
  • Motorway: 130 km/h
  • Alcohol limit: 0,0 ‰

Do I need an international driving permit in Ukraine?
Requirements depend on your home country. EU, US and UK licenses are generally accepted, but an International Driving Permit (IDP) is recommended if your license isn't in Latin script.

Is there an age limit for renting a car at BC Zaporizhzhia Train Station?
The minimum age to rent in Ukraine is typically 21 years. Drivers under 25 often pay an additional young driver surcharge.
